你查询的IP:[220.252.80.226]  地理位置:中国–北京–北京

最新查询117.75.13.254 123.253.15.146 221.200.213.178 119.78.196.103 124.196.252.10 114.54.227.149 116.112.135.34 202.192.159.164 202.95.217.221 220.252.80.226 192.83.169.69 116.193.32.21 203.119.32.248 125.62.230.85 61.128.115.191 203.93.63.21 202.60.112.208 202.160.176.193 122.8.234.234 118.66.131.36 116.214.32.15 211.160.238.248 60.150.20.89 118.120.155.93 119.42.224.226 203.175.192.19 118.72.117.122 124.28.192.115 202.85.208.45 221.198.20.146 122.119.185.174